From: Wen Yang In-Reply-To: <2025092924-anemia-antidote-dad1@gregkh> Content-Type: text/plain; charset=UTF-8; format=flowed Content-Transfer-Encoding: 7bit X-Migadu-Flow: FLOW_OUT On 9/29/25 21:21, Greg Kroah-Hartman wrote: > On Sat, Sep 27, 2025 at 01:46:58AM +0800, Wen Yang wrote: >> From: Pierre Gondois >> >> commit 5944ce092b97caed5d86d961e963b883b5c44ee2 upstream. >> >> adds a call to detect_cache_attributes() to populate the cacheinfo >> before updating the siblings mask. detect_cache_attributes() allocates >> memory and can take the PPTT mutex (on ACPI platforms). On PREEMPT_RT >> kernels, on secondary CPUs, this triggers a: >> 'BUG: sleeping function called from invalid context' [1] >> as the code is executed with preemption and interrupts disabled. >> >> The primary CPU was previously storing the cache information using >> the now removed (struct cpu_topology).llc_id: >> commit 5b8dc787ce4a ("arch_topology: Drop LLC identifier stash from >> the CPU topology") >> >> allocate_cache_info() tries to build the cacheinfo from the primary >> CPU prior secondary CPUs boot, if the DT/ACPI description >> contains cache information. >> If allocate_cache_info() fails, then fallback to the current state >> for the cacheinfo allocation. [1] will be triggered in such case. >> >> When unplugging a CPU, the cacheinfo memory cannot be freed. If it >> was, then the memory would be allocated early by the re-plugged >> CPU and would trigger [1]. >> >> Note that populate_cache_leaves() might be called multiple times >> due to populate_leaves being moved up.
